Signs You May Have Hidden Water Damage

  • Warped floors
  • Soft subflooring
  • Bubbling paint
  • Ceiling stains
  • Musty odors
  • Swollen trim or baseboards
  • Cracking drywall
  • Microbial Growth
  • Sagging ceilings

What To Do After Water Damage

Water damage can happen quickly and spread throughout your home faster than most homeowners realize. Whether caused by a plumbing leak, storm damage, appliance failure, roof leak, or flooding, acting fast is critical to minimizing long-term damage and preventing mold growth. At New Beginnings Construction, our team is ready to help restore and rebuild your home. While waiting for our team to arrive, here are important water damage safety tips to keep in mind.

DO:

  • Call New Beginnings Construction immediately.
  • Shut off the water source if it is safe to do so.
  • Turn off electricity in affected areas if water is near outlets or appliances.
  • Document visible damage with photos and videos for insurance purposes.
  • Remove excess standing water if safe.
  • Move furniture, rugs, electronics, and valuables away from affected areas.
  • Place aluminum foil or protective barriers under furniture legs to reduce staining and damage.
  • Open windows and doors for ventilation if weather permits.
  • Use fans or dehumidifiers if safe and available.
  • Contact your insurance company to begin the claims process.
  • Keep receipts for emergency repairs, temporary lodging, and mitigation services.
  • Monitor for signs of swelling, buckling, or sagging materials.

DO NOT:

  • Do not enter rooms with sagging ceilings or compromised flooring.
  • Do not use electrical appliances in wet areas.
  • Do not turn on HVAC systems if water damage may have impacted the system.
  • Do not attempt major water extraction or structural repairs yourself.
  • Do not ignore hidden moisture behind walls, flooring, or cabinets.
  • Do not leave wet materials untreated for extended periods, as microbial growth can begin developing quickly.
  • Do not use household vacuums to remove water.
  • Do not disturb materials that may contain excess moisture or contamination.
  • Do not delay professional drying, mitigation, and reconstruction services.
  • Do not assume surfaces are dry simply because they appear dry visually.
